Independent Curriculum, teacher strategies, Christian Religious EducationAbstract
This study aimed to analyze Christian Religious Education (CEE) teachers’ strategies in implementing the Independent Curriculum at the high school level. The curriculum emphasizes the development of student competence and independence, so PAK teachers play an important role as facilitators of Christian values-based learning. Using qualitative methods through literature review, observation, and documentation, the results of the study indicate that PAK teachers apply student-centered learning, use creative methods, and encourage spiritual reflection in their daily lives. Teachers also play a mentor role in relating Christian values to contemporary challenges. Supportive factors include teacher training, school facilities, and community support. However, challenges such as resource constraints and adaptation to a new curriculum remain. In conclusion, the implementation of the Independence Curriculum requires a holistic approach, learning innovation, and collaboration with various relevant parties.
